David L. Dull is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, David L. Dull has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 2.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 6 papers in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ine and 5 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in David L. Dull's work include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(6 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(5 papers) and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(4 papers). David L. Dull is often cited by papers focused on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(6 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(5 papers) and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(4 papers). David L. Dull collaborates with scholars based in United States, Mexico and France. David L. Dull's co-authors include Harry S. Mosher, James A. Dale, John H. Tinker, Frederick W. Cheney, Richard J. Ward, Robert A. Caplan, Robert B. Forbes, David J. Murray, M. P. Mehta and David A. Jaeger and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ry and The Journal of Organic Chemistry.
